Thai Manufacturing Sector Fades In June - S&P Global

(RTTNews) - The manufacturing sector in Thailand continued to expand in June, albeit at a slower pace, the latest survey from S&P Global showed on Friday with a manufacturing PMI score of 50.7.

That's down from 51.9 in May although it remains above the boom-or-bust line of 50 that separates expansion from contraction.

The headline PMI was consistent with a sixth month of improvement in the health of the Thai manufacturing sector. That said, the rate of growth was mild and the slowest in the current sequence of expansion.

Looking beyond the headline figure, June data indicated that production across the Thai manufacturing sector expanded for a tenth month running. That said, the rate of growth fell considerably from May to a five-month low. Anecdotal evidence suggested that declining market demand weighed negatively on production volumes.

Thai GDP Growth Weakens In Q2

Thailand's economy logged a slower growth in the second quarter on softer consumption and tourism related activities but the outlook for the year was upgraded citing strong investment, spending and exports. Gross domestic product grew 1.9 percent from the previous year, which was slower than the 2.8 percent expansion posted in the first quarter

Thai GDP Growth Beats Expectations

Thailand's economy grew more than expected in the first quarter, underpinned by resilient domestic demand and strong exports, while regional peers reported weaker growth due to the impact of the war in the Middle East. Gross domestic product logged an annual growth of 2.8 percent in the first quarter, the National Economic and Social Development Council said Monday.

Thai GDP Growth Accelerates On Domestic Demand

Thailand's economic growth accelerated more than expected in the fourth quarter on strong domestic demand, official data revealed Monday. The annual growth in gross domestic product more than doubled to 2.5 percent in the fourth quarter from 1.2 percent in third quarter, the National Economic and Social Development Council reported. Economists had forecast the rate to ease to 1.0 percent.

Thai Central Bank Cuts Rate By 25 Bps

Thailand's central bank lowered its key interest rate by a quarter-point on Wednesday as economic growth is forecast to moderate further amid subdued inflation. The Monetary Policy Committee of the Bank of Thailand unanimously decided to cut the policy rate by 25 basis points to 1.25 percent from 1.50 percent. Previously, the bank had lowered the policy rate by 25 basis points each in August.
